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,380,513,908
Lastest Block:
2,062,858
Utxos:
1,983,903
Nodes:
296
OmniXEP Contracts:
281
Block details
[STAKE]
12/03/2026 16:43:44 UTC
Txid
b43f991db607ac2ac7b6f6fe636ae5290ab829e5b256f7f93a3e955f45117781
Block
2,054,209
Block hash
fe71d2a5cbcd1c5516c8acbca0d5794583246e955815c255f3de652b15c55709
Stake reward
386.2674778 XEP
Sender
ep1qf7x5cgfmr4e9323p3u72kyfy6nmg4gr39n3mh0
Recipient
ep1qf7x5cgfmr4e9323p3u72kyfy6nmg4gr39n3mh0
(2,302,083.99182618 XEP)